Repeated exercise training produces persistent improvements in skeletal muscle insulin sensitivity through up-regulation of GLUT4, AMPK, and lipid oxidation pathways, whereas a single bout of exercise only provides a transient (approx. 48h) insulin-sensitizing effect.

To fix insulin resistance, you need to train consistently, not just occasionally. While one workout helps for a day or two, only regular exercise builds the lasting muscle adaptations (like more GLUT4 and better fat burning) that keep your blood sugar stable long-term. Focus on building a routine rather than chasing a single 'perfect' session.

In contrast, repeated physical activity (i.e. exercise training) results in a persistent increase in insulin action in skeletal muscle from obese and insulin-resistant individuals... However, this 'insulin sensitizing' effect is short-lived and disappears after ~48 h.
John A. Hawley et al. · Acta Physiologica · 2007
